In a dramatic turn of events, Coronation Street's beloved café owner Roy Cropper, portrayed by David Neilson, finds himself the victim of a sudden and violent attack in the latest episode released on ITVX. The shocking scenes, which have not yet aired on traditional television but are available for streaming, depict Roy being punched by a stranger in his own café, leaving viewers stunned.
A Surprising Confrontation
The incident unfolds when a man named Mal enters Roy's café carrying a bouquet of flowers. Initially appearing as a customer, Mal quickly turns aggressive, confronting Roy about sending the flowers to his wife. Without warning, he delivers a punch to Roy's face, catching the gentle café owner completely off guard. This violent outburst stems from a complex web of misunderstandings involving Roy's recent correspondence.
Roy's Developing Relationship
Over recent weeks, Roy has been exchanging letters and texts with a woman named Alice, who initially contacted him to thank him for writing to her son in prison. Their communication has grown increasingly frequent, with Roy developing genuine feelings for his pen pal. However, Alice has omitted a crucial detail from their conversations: she is already married to Mal, with whom she has shared 31 years and raised three children.
Mal discovered the text messages between Roy and Alice, followed by the flowers Roy sent as an apology after their planned meeting was cancelled. Believing Roy to be knowingly pursuing his wife, Mal's anger boiled over into physical violence within the café's familiar surroundings.
Friends Rally to Roy's Defence
Fortunately, Roy is not alone during this distressing confrontation. Regulars Mary Taylor and Nina Lucas immediately come to his defence, vouching for his character and integrity. They assure Mal that Roy is a gentleman who would never intentionally involve himself with a married woman.
As Roy explains the innocent nature of his relationship with Alice – emphasizing that he was unaware of her marital status – Mal begins to realise the truth. The realisation that his wife has been dishonest leads to a moment of remorse, with Mal apologising to Roy for his violent actions while lamenting the state of his marriage.
Aftermath and Future Implications
The episode doesn't conclude with this confrontation, as Mal later heads out to drown his sorrows, potentially leading another local character astray in his distressed state. Meanwhile, Roy is left to process the revelation about Alice's marriage and the physical attack he has endured.
